Output d66435bb8a57e8bd9bb782c565e609d333a5317dab1801f7a0da15e413e47119:75

value
2422555
script pubkey
OP_0 OP_PUSHBYTES_20 2706398925fec62beab97b59bb9437549f4caf3d
address
bc1qyurrnzf9lmrzh64e0dvmh9ph2j05eteawg3g4q
transaction
d66435bb8a57e8bd9bb782c565e609d333a5317dab1801f7a0da15e413e47119